🐰 But “detachable” should never be treated as only a cute selling point—especially for products positioned for children under 3. Product design, attachment methods, intended use, and destination-market requirements all need to be considered as part of responsible product development.
✨ For professional buyers, the first question should not be “How many characters can we add?” A more important question is whether the structure, dimensions, attachment method, testing, labeling, and intended-use instructions support the target age and destination market.
🍼 For products marketed to children under 3, small-part and detachable-component risks require careful assessment. U.S. CPSC guidance addresses products intended for children under three and potential risks of detachable or released components, while EU toy rules also impose requirements on detachable parts when a product falls within toy regulations. Exact classification depends on the product and how it is marketed.
💫 That means age positioning should be supported by appropriate product assessment and market-specific compliance—not simply printed on a package. Buyers and suppliers should align product claims, testing plans, labeling, and sales-market requirements before finalizing a collection.
🌟 This is where the business model becomes interesting. With a conventional fixed-decoration headband, 1 new character = 1 new complete headband SKU, which can increase assortment complexity and inventory commitments.
🎈 With a modular detachable system, the base headband becomes the platform, while character themes become the refresh mechanism. A retailer can build the assortment around ⭐ 3 core characters for stable year-round merchandising and 🎉 1 seasonal character for campaign refreshes.
🌷 Instead of repeatedly rebuilding an entire collection, buyers can create new visual stories around the same base concept. This approach remains subject to detachable components meeting required age-grading, testing, labeling, and market-specific requirements.
🐣 The result is a more flexible approach to SKU planning, assortment management, seasonal merchandising, repeat-purchase concepts, and private-label development. For B2B buyers, this can create more room to experiment with character stories without multiplying complete-product SKUs at the same pace.
